A FringeNYC Encore: When you teach third grade, you can't tell your students everything. Micaela Blei comes clean about classroom disasters, falling in love, and forging letters from an imaginary Queen. More…
This autobiographical solo show is written and performed by two-time Moth GrandSLAM champion Micaela Blei.
